-Description: Add allow-sendfilefd flag for Debian GNU/kFreeBSD
- On Debian GNU/kFreeBSD (FreeBSD kernel plus glibc), the BSD flavour of
- sendfile is not usable, but Cabal treats kfreebsdgnu as os(freebsd) so I
- had to add a flag to simple-sendfile.cabal to make it possible to select
- the fallback implementation. See
- https://github.com/kazu-yamamoto/simple-sendfile/pull/13 for more details.
- .
- warp.cabal reflects the availability of interfaces from simple-sendfile,
- and so I believe it needs a matching flag to make it possible to forcibly
- disable the use of -DSENDFILEFD.
-Author: Colin Watson <cjwatson@debian.org>
-Forwarded: https://github.com/yesodweb/wai/pull/164
-Last-Update: 2013-06-15
